Kathmandu – Kailash – Kathmandu via Zhang-Mu Kathmandu has become a popular gateway to Mt. Kailash and Lake Manasarovar tour. This 12 days tour is one of the most popular tours to Mt. Kailash and Lake Manasarovar from Kathmandu that commences with an overland journey to Zhang-Mu, Tibetan border town which is five hours drive from Kathmandu.
Another one day drive from Zhang-Mu takes us to Saga. This program includes three days circumambulation tour around Mt. Kailash as well as one day stay at the shore of Lake Manasarover (Chiu Gompa side). For the remaining of the tour, we will travel to Mt. Kailash and Lake Manasarovar and then return back to Kathmandu. An alternative option is to end the tour in Lhasa.
The best time to visit Mt. Kailash and Lake Manasarovar is between May and September. However, people travel in this region from April until the end of october. After October the weather in Mt. Kailash becomes very cold.

Begin the three-day Mount Kailash Kora trek. The trail gradually ascends along the Lha Chu Valley with stunning views of the north face of Mount Kailash. Reach Dera Phuk Gompa, located directly beneath Kailash’s dramatic north wall. Overnight at guesthouse or camp.

The most challenging and sacred day of the trek. Ascend steeply to Dolma La Pass, the highest point of the Kailash Kora, adorned with prayer flags. Descend past Gauri Kund, a revered sacred lake, before reaching Zutul Phuk Gompa, associated with the meditation cave of Milarepa. Overnight at guesthouse or camp.
